Transaction ffdb51d1de1e859dc6dc442a18d3e846c244c71b1ded53dd0ee9d62667e2fb9a
3 Input
2 Outputs
- ffdb51d1de1e859dc6dc442a18d3e846c244c71b1ded53dd0ee9d62667e2fb9a:0
- ffdb51d1de1e859dc6dc442a18d3e846c244c71b1ded53dd0ee9d62667e2fb9a:1
value 134484
address 1MVZt6yx8wE7hv4nwYzYecwM8CxF8R5ZDM
value 1641367
address 37aephTHFy2ZYuZgMhGkP63VKmhuLQXLFS